Widening of Minjur-T’vanam road in Chennai nears completion

In Chennai, another road that provides connectivity to places in north Chennai is expected to be ready by February end. The 17.4 km-long Minjur-Kattur-Thirupalaivanam Road that is being strengthened and widened at a cost of Rs 36.64 crore, will help residents of villages including Neidavoyal, Thiruvallavoyal and Thathamanji.

Chennai’s Thiruvanmiyur to get four-lane flyover

In Chennai, work to construct a 1.3 km-long flyover crossing three junctions in Thiruvanmiyur is likely to commence by September. According to the proposal, the flyover will cross the Jayanthi-Theyagaraja theatres junction, the one after the Marundeeswarar temple and the RTO office.

BGR generators for NTPCs project

To supply two 800-MW steam turbine generators for NTPCÂ’s Lara Super Thermal Power Project, BGR Energy is set to start work on the Rs 1,548-crore contract in Chattisgarh. The NTPC project is a 4,000 MW project of 5 x800 mw and the Chennai-based BGR Energy will provide two (2x800 MW) steam turbine generators for the project.

Maldivian Airlines, Apollo tie-up to benefit mutually

To benefit mutually Maldivian Airlines and the Chennai-headquartered Apollo Hospitals have got into an agreement to give discounts to each others’ clients. For example, Apollo Hospitals will give a discount on its service charges for those who fly the airline, and the airline will give similar discounts to the hospital’s patients on the airfare.
